Welcome to on-call for Tollwright, our rules engine that computes shipping fees for every Cartfield order. Rules live in versioned bundles; never edit them live. When evaluations fail, check the bundle hash first, then the engine's health endpoint. To query the internal admin API during incidents, authenticate with the service key below, stored also in the vault:

gateway credential: vxb15-ybzv6EpZJxoKxSj

Handover: Tomas, here's the state of the N+1 fix in the Plover graph layer. We batched the resolver for member lookups via a dataloader keyed per request, so no cross-tenant leakage is possible. Query depth limits are unchanged. Please verify the loader cache scoping during your review. The exact service settings used in staging are listed below for your audit.

settings of kagag-kagef:
[kelath]
port = 9300
region = west-4
host = kelath.olvarqworks.example
team = sorion
timeout_ms = 1000
retries = 8

### Key Ceremony Checklist — Item 7: FareLogic Signing Key

New team members: FareLogic is our rules engine that computes shipping fees per region and carrier tier. Before rotating its rule-bundle signing key, confirm both custodians from the Harrowgate office are present, the ceremony laptop is offline, and the previous key's revocation notice is drafted. Record start time in the ledger. To decrypt the custodian share envelope, enter the passphrase below.

unlock words, fafop-hawep: briwyn-oliix-sorox

### Changelog — Tallyforge 4.2.1

Changed defaults: spreadsheet export no longer buffers entire workbooks in memory. The streaming writer is now on by default, which drops peak RSS by roughly 60% on big exports. If anyone was relying on the old in-memory path for custom post-processing hooks, they'll need to opt back in. For the release notes, the new default configuration ships as follows.

config for tawif-bagef:
[sorwyn]
team = sorys
access_code = ac_9ba40c
host = sorwyn.ordingrid.local
port = 5000
owner = aldok.quenion
peer = belath.paliqcloud.local